Key Terms and Glossary

Common terms you may see include debtor, demand letter, judgment, garnishment, and settlement.

DEBTOR

A person or business that owes money on an unpaid invoice.

GARNISHMENT

A legal process to collect money from a debtor’s wages or assets after a judgment.

DEMAND LETTER

A formal letter requesting payment and outlining next steps if payment is not received.

DEFAULT JUDGMENT

A court judgment entered when a debtor fails to respond or defend a collection action.

Legal Process at Our Firm

From initial assessment to enforcement, we outline the path, timelines, and expected costs tailored to Carpinteria and Santa Barbara County.

Step 1: Initial Assessment

We review documents, identify the debtor, and determine the best path forward.

Document Review

We gather invoices, contracts, and related correspondence.

Demand Letter

We prepare and send a formal demand letter outlining the amount due and potential next steps.

Step 2: Negotiation and Settlement

We negotiate payment terms or settlements with the debtor and monitor progress.

Negotiation Phase

We discuss payment options, timelines, and any disputes.

Documentation

We record any agreements in writing and file if necessary.

Step 3: Enforcement and Recovery

If required, we pursue court action and enforcement measures.

Filing a Complaint

We prepare and file the complaint with the proper court.

Post-Judgment Enforcement

We pursue wage garnishment, liens, or other remedies as allowed.

Do I need a lawyer to collect unpaid invoices in California?

Yes, consulting with a attorney who understands California collection rules can help you evaluate options and plan the next steps. A professional can prepare demand letters, discuss settlements, and explain court options if needed. Understanding your rights early can save time and reduce friction with the debtor.
